Life of Saint Paul

Book cover
By: (1869-1936)

"Life of Saint Paul" by Frances Alice Forbes is a captivating and detailed account of the incredible life and accomplishments of the apostle Paul. Forbes skillfully weaves together historical facts with biblical passages to create a vivid portrait of Paul's journey from persecutor of Christians to one of the most influential figures in the early Christian church. The book delves into Paul's missionary travels, his letters to various congregations, and his unwavering commitment to spreading the gospel message. Forbes' writing is both informative and engaging, making this a must-read for anyone interested in learning more about the life of this significant biblical figure. Overall, "Life of Saint Paul" is a well-researched and enlightening book that sheds light on the enduring impact of Paul's teachings and legacy.

Book Description:
A short biography of Saint Paul, the Apostle of the Gentiles, from the time of his persecution of the Christians to his martyrdom.
